hmmm. well the majority of times vests have fasteners on the back to make them fit less sloppy. when you tried on the vests did you adjust these? im all about having the slimmest fit but even with the most basic vests i have not run into that much of a fit problem after tightening the clasp on the back. dress shirts on the other hand i simply cannot buy without having them tailored for a proper fit.

it is not a must to buy the same brand/line vest as the pants. though this might be helpful when trying to match specific fabrics or colors.
